What does B.F. Goodrich shipping tires directly to General Motors illustrate?

  1. Intermediary channel of distribution.

  2. Indirect channel of distribution.

  3. Intensive channel of distribution.

  4. Direct channel of distribution.

The correct answer is: Direct channel of distribution.

The scenario of B.F. Goodrich shipping tires directly to General Motors exemplifies a direct channel of distribution. In this system, the producer (B.F. Goodrich) ships products directly to the end user (General Motors) without any intermediaries such as wholesalers or retailers. This direct interaction allows for greater control over the distribution process, potentially reducing costs and lead times associated with additional handling. This direct relationship can also foster stronger collaboration and communication between the manufacturer and the buyer, enhancing the fulfillment of specific requirements or specifications for the tires. By eliminating middlemen, it can streamline logistics, increase efficiency, and potentially lead to more customized service, which is particularly important in manufacturing supply chains. The other options involve varying degrees of intermediary involvement, which are not present in this direct shipping scenario. The core of the example is the direct transactional relationship that facilitates a more efficient supply chain between B.F. Goodrich and General Motors.
